> Luckily an old friend of mine found 2 Disks in his stock, another RF31 (not
> tried jet) and an RF73.
> I've changed now the working but still almost empty RF71 in my VAX4000-300
> against that RF73 disk and tried to integrate it to the system.
> It starts with all LEDs on (as the other do), begins to rattle a little
> with the head assembly (as the others do) but stops then and begins to
> reposition somewhere in 0.5s cycles. It never finishes doing that, it is
> not going to ready. The ready led is blinking for a short time after every
> 0,5s cycle. I've tried to talk with the disk using the KA670 Firmware
> with set host/dup/dssi/bus:0 2, PARAMS is working and STATUS is responding,
> the displayed last failure was 3304(X) and I don't know what that could be..
> 
> All other commands do work, but they are aborted since the disk is busy.
> 
> The available RF72DUG8 gives the hint that the error codes are listed in
> the service manuals, but it seems that those manuals aren't available
> somewhere.
> 
> What could the error be? Is the disk dead?
